Swaffham is an historic market town, located approximately 30 miles from the Cathedral City of Norwich, 16 miles from King's Lynn, 17 miles from both Sandringham and Thetford Forest and 28 miles from the coastal town of Hunstanton. The beautiful Norfolk Broads are also only about an hours' drive away. Swaffham boasts ample free parking within the town and has a small social history museum, many public houses, restaurants and cafes, together with supermarket facilities and smaller shops. Within the town there are schooling facilities for all ages and sport and leisure facilities. Swaffham market is held every Saturday and has stalls including fresh meat, fruit & vegetables, cheeses, eggs, confectionery, tools and plants. There are direct train links to Cambridge and London Kings Cross from nearby Downham Market.Council Tax Band
